Weather in Warsaw in August

Poland · 20-year averages, August

Prime time. If you get to pick your dates, August is the one. Highs average 25.8 °C, lows 14.3 °C, and rain falls on 11 days — nothing in the month is working against you.

August ranks 2 of 12 in Warsaw. Only September scores clearly higher, and the difference is small enough to be settled by price rather than weather.

Rain on 11 days, 2 of them heavy. Enough to need a plan B, not enough to need a plan around it. Nothing specialised needed — this is the month you pack for the trip rather than for the weather.

What the averages hide

Averages flatten a month, and this one hides a few things: 5 days top 30 °C — hot spells arrive, but they break. Across the twenty years measured, the hottest August day reached 36.9 °C and the coldest night fell to 6.4 °C, and the wettest single day dropped 45 mm — roughly 73% of the month's rain in one day.

August is moderately variable: 7 mm in the driest year against 175 mm in the wettest, around an average of 62 mm. Roughly two Augusts in three land near that average, and the third does something else entirely.

Wind is light at 8.6 km/h, so the temperature on the page is close to the temperature on your skin, and humidity is unremarkable at 66%.

How August sits in the year

Temperatures hold steady either side: 25.8 °C in July, 25.8 here, 20.4 in September. Nothing about the timing within the month matters much.

Daylight in August

14.8 hours of daylight, losing 1.8 hours across the month. That is between Warsaw's extremes of 16.7 and 7.8 hours, so days are long enough not to constrain the plan.

An inland climate

With no coast nearby, the year swings a fair way — 32.5 °C between the warmest afternoons and the coldest nights, wider than any coastal city at this latitude would manage.
